Hong Kong SAR has, over the recent years, become an equity trading hub catering to domestic and foreign investors, including increasingly to investors from Mainland China. Most trading is conducted on markets operated by recognized exchange companies, with limited domestic trading happening via automated trading services (ATS) providers in the form of alternative liquidity pools. The introduction of Stock Connect in 2014 enabled investors from Hong Kong (including domestic and foreign) to directly invest in the Shanghai and later Shenzhen markets and investors from the Mainland to directly access the Hong Kong market. Trading via Stock Connect has seen a steady rise over the last few years, increasing the linkages between Hong Kong SAR and the Mainland. Mainland companies currently account for over 60 per cent of market capitalization of the equities traded on the Stock Exchange of Hong Kong (SEHK).

Keller (1998) reexamines Coe and Helpman’s (1995) analysis of international R&D spillovers focusing on the weights used to define the foreign R&D capital stock. Keller creates “random” weights and shows that they give rise to positive estimates of international R&D spillovers, casting doubts on the robustness of Coe and Helpman’s findings. We show that Keller’s “random” weights are essentially simple averages with a random error. We derive alternative random weights and present regressions showing that when they are used to define the foreign R&D capital stock, the estimated international R&D spillover estimates are nonexistent, as would be expected.

Automated trade execution systems are examined with respect to the degree to which they automate the price discovery process. Seven levels of automation of price discovery are identified, and 47 systems are classified according to these criteria. Systems operating at various levels of automation are compared with respect to age, geographical location, and type of securities traded. Information provided to market participants, and asymmetries of information between traders with direct access to the automated market and outside investors also are examined. It is found, for example, that the degree of asymmetric information increases with the level of automation of price discovery. The potential for trading abuses related to prearranged trading, noncompetitive execution, and trading ahead of customers is analyzed for each level of automation. Certain levels of automation widen the opportunities for trading abuses in some respects, but may narrow them in others.

A taxonomy of existing and planned automated trade execution systems in financial markets is provided. Over 50 automated market structures in 16 countries are analyzed. The classification scheme is organized around the principle that such markets consist of an algorithm that performs a trade matching function, together with information display and transmission mechanisms. Automated market structures are classified by ordered sets of trade execution priority rules, trade matching protocols and associated degree of automation of price discovery, and transparency, to include informational asymmetries between classes of market participants. Systematic differences in systems across types of financial instruments, geographical market centers, and over time are analyzed.
